Khurangan (Persian: خورنگان))[a] is a village in Now Bandegan Rural District of Now Bandegan District, Fasa County, Fars province, Iran.

At the 2006 National Census, its population was 2,619 in 626 households.[4] The following census in 2011 counted 2,493 people in 727 households.[5] The latest census in 2016 showed a population of 2,437 people in 732 households. It was the most populous village in its rural district.[2]
